Course Content
In this course, students are introduced to project management, risk management, work plan development, and thesis writing guidelines. Throughout the project process, they define the problem, conduct a literature review, and proceed to the conceptual design stage. Students maintain regular meetings with their advisors while continuing design, analysis, prototype, or simulation studies. At the end of the process, a project report is prepared, revised according to feedback, and the course concludes with a presentation and evaluation phase.
Objectives of the Course
The aim of this course is to develop students'abilities to plan, execute, and finalize a project process. Through experience in problem identification, literature review, design, and reporting, students gain a comprehensive understanding of project management.

Weekly Detailed Course Contents
Week Topics
1 Introduction to Project Management, Risk Management, Preparation of Work Plan, Thesis Writing Rules, and Discussion of the Topic in Global and Social Contexts
2 Problem Identification and Clarification of the Project Topic
3 Conducting Literature and Source Review, Examination of Existing Studies
4 Preparation of Conceptual Design and Work Plan
5 Consultation with Advisor, Defining Project Objectives and Methods
6 Design Studies and Preliminary Evaluations
7 Advancing Design Studies and Developing Alternative Solutions
8 Consultation with Advisor and Evaluation of Obtained Results
9 Continuation of Design and Analysis Studies
10 Conducting Prototype or Simulation Studies
11 Completion of Design and Initiation of Report Preparation
12 Continuation of Report Writing and Implementation of Advisor Feedback
13 Finalization of the Report and Preparation for Presentation
14 Project Presentation, Evaluation, and Final Review Meeting
